For department heads. Current state: Quillon Devices remains single-sourced on the actuator housing from Bramwell Castings. Risk rated high. Procurement screened four alternates; two passed initial quality audits. Tooling costs for a second source estimated at mid six figures, payback under two years given current volumes. Recommendation: fund qualification of one alternate this quarter, hold the second as backup. Decision needed by month-end to hit next year's build plan. Related planning detail follows.

board note of bajop-yaweg: The western region missed its Pelys quota by 58.0 percent last quarter. Pelysek Foods plans to raise the Belius list price by 44.0 percent in July. The steering committee signed off on a budget of $133.8 million for Project Pelax. The renewal with Zoraelix Systems closes at $61.9 million a year, 12.7 percent above the last contract.

Subject: Key rotation — Schema Registry

Hi folks,

Heads-up for anyone new: we rotated the credentials for the Ledgerline event schema registry this morning. The old key stops working Friday, so update your local env before then. Schema validation jobs and the Fencepost producer both use the same credential, nothing else changes. Grab the new key from this message and swap it in. Here's the replacement key.

service key, tadup-tahog: zpat7_wB1tnEL

## Schema Registry: Who to Contact

The Fennelworks event schema registry (internally called Loomcatalog) is owned by the Stream Platform team. New event schemas require a review before registration, and breaking changes must be flagged in advance. As a contractor, you won't have merge rights on the registry repo, so route all schema proposals through the team's intake queue. For access requests, review questions, or urgent compatibility issues, reach the Stream Platform team at the address below.

alerts address for bawif-hahig: norwyn_gorys_lamath@olvarqlabs.test